The UAE’s largest non-oil company, Emirates Global Aluminium, has confirmed that its smelter site was damaged in an Iranian attack. This is a serious development because the company is a key part of the UAE’s economy, supplying aluminium globally and supporting major industries.

In simple English: Iran hit an important factory in the UAE, not oil, but another major industry. This shows the conflict is spreading beyond oil targets and hitting broader economic infrastructure, which could affect jobs, exports, and global supply chains.
